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of organic synthesis technology, and in particular to a method for preparing a 1,2,4-triazol-3-one compound. Background Technology

[0002] 1,2,4-Triazol-3-ones are an important class of five-membered nitrogen heterocyclic compounds with a variety of biological activities. These special N-heterocyclic compounds have been successfully applied in various fields and have significant biological activities. For example, 2,4,5-trisubstituted-3H-1,2,4-triazol-3-ones with an acidic biphenylsulfonamide moiety have been used as dual AT1 / AT2 receptor antagonists with enhanced affinity.

[0003] The synthetic routes for 1,2,4-triazol-3-ones have received considerable attention over the past few decades. Although numerous synthetic methods for producing 1,2,4-triazol-3-ones have been reported, most conventionally developed strategies suffer from several drawbacks, such as substrate pre-activation, multi-step procedures, harsh reaction conditions, low efficiency, or the generation of undesirable byproducts. Given the urgent need for environmental friendliness and sustainability, green synthesis has become a mainstream alternative to conventional synthetic routes.

[0004] Therefore, it is necessary to develop a safe, environmentally friendly, low-cost, efficient, and simple method for the effective synthesis of 1,2,4-triazol-3-one compounds and their derivatives. Summary of the Invention

[0013] According to some embodiments of the present invention, R 1 and R 2 Selected independently from C 1~6 Alkyl, phenyl, C 1~6 alkyl, C 1~6 alkoxy, halogen, C 1~6 Halogenated alkoxy groups and nitro-substituted phenyl groups.

[0014]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the molar ratio of compound 1 to compound 2 is 1:(1 to 3).

[0015]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the molar ratio of compound 1, base and oxidant is 1:(0.8-1.5):(1-1.5).

[0016]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the base is selected from at least one of lithium acetate, sodium acetate, cesium acetate, and tetrabutylammonium iodide.

[0017]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the oxidant is selected from at least one of copper acetate, iodobenzene acetate, iodobenzene iodoacetate, tert-butanol hydroperoxide, and di-tert-butyl peroxide.

[0018]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the temperature of the reaction is 0°C to 80°C.

[0019]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the reaction temperature is 40°C to 80°C.

[0020]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the reaction time is 0.5 to 24 hours.

[0021]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the solvent is selected from at least one of DMSO, THF, acetonitrile, and toluene.

[0022]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the reaction further includes a purification step after completion.

[0023] According to some embodiments of the present invention, the purification is performed using column chromatography.

[0064] Example 1

[0065] Example 1 provides a method for preparing a 1,2,4-triazol-3-one compound. The synthetic route and steps are as follows:

[0066]

[0067] 0.5 mmol of p-toluene isocyanate, 0.6 mmol of 4-fluorobenzylamidine hydrochloride, 0.5 mmol of tetrabutylammonium iodide, 0.4 mmol of iodobenzene acetate, 0.2 mmol of copper acetate, and 1 mL of DMSO were sequentially added to a 25 mL screw-top test tube. The mixture was stirred at 80 °C for 8 hours. After the reaction was completed, the mixture was cooled to room temperature to obtain the crude product. The crude product was purified by column chromatography to obtain product 3aa, with a yield of 61% and a purity of 99%.

[0068] The obtained product 3aa is a pale yellow solid, and its proton, carbon, and fluorine spectra are shown below. Figure 1 and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, the structural characterization data are as follows:

[0069] Rf=0.5(petroleum ether:ethyl acetate=3:1); 1 H NMR (500MHz, DMSO-d6) δ12.66(s,1H),7.99–7.94(m,2H),7.89–7.83(m,2H),7.41(t,J=8.8Hz,2H),7.30–7.26(m,2H),2.33(s,3H). 13 C NMR (126MHz, DMSO-d6) δ164.8,162.8,153.2,144.3,135.9,134.6,129.9,128.2,128.1,123.3,123.3,118.5,116.8,116.6,21.0. 19 F NMR(471M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-109.73.
